i moved the scope about 1" back and went out and shot it and got 2 to group then had a stray...im shooting remington factory ammo so i changed it up and got a box of federal to try and they grouped alot better....i got a 3 shot 1" group at 100yds with all the holes touching with shootin sticks....alot better than the other day....im sure i could have done better with a table and rest but im happy for now with the results...thanks for helpin guys...i would have over looked that simple mistake and probably sent the scope in  :tup:
